Fort Collins Adaptive Climbing Community Night

Join us to learn rope work, belay commands, climber movement, and gym etiquette, fostering confidence in climbers of all levels. Climbing benefits individuals with disabilities like PTSD, amputations, and TBIs, aiding fine motor skills, coordination, balance, core control, problem-solving, and focus. We embrace all abilities and aim to give back to the community. Participants of any age, gender, or ability are welcome no experience or equipment necessary! Wear comfortable clothing; we provide harnesses and shoes.

Cost: The climbing gym offers reduced fees (around $20) for non-veteran participants for a harness, shoes, and day pass.
